Robert Miller v. Kohl's Department Stores Inc et al
Filing
19
ORDER RE DISMISSAL by Judge Dolly M. Gee: Upon Stipulation 18 , this action is hereby ordered dismissed with prejudice, each party to bear his or its own attorneys' fees and costs. The Court shall retain jurisdiction to enforce the terms of the settlement. (gk)
